Fitzwater heads to Texas and heads groceries fueling his 2025 bodybuilding season.
Surging Men’s Open Pro Martin Fitzwater is leaving Florida for the Lone Star state. With preparations for the 2025 Pittsburgh Pro heating up, Fitzwater shed light on why he made the move to Texas and what groceries fuel his physique.
Fitzwater’s ascent in the Men’s Open division has been anything but ordinary. After winning the 2024 Detroit Pro, he ranked second to Nick Walker in New York. His most recent season culminated with a fourth-place debut at Mr. Olympia.
Then, Fitzwater out-muscled Classic Physique great Chris Bumstead in Bumstead’s Open performance at the Prague Pro. Not short on momentum, Fitzwater’s already 2025 Mr. Olympia-qualified, thanks to that triumph.

Fitzwater’s New Home and What That Means for His Bodybuilding Career
Texas is the training birthplace of bodybuilding legends, including eight-time Mr. Olympia kingpin Ronnie Coleman and Branch Warren, who forged freakish physiques throwing iron around at the rugged Metroflex Gym in Arlington, TX.
Fitzwater, guided by Warren in 2022, plans to bring an even grittier look in 2025 with the help of his current coach, Stefan Kienzl. “It’s a sigh of relief,” Fitzwater shared about his move from Florida.
While Fitzwater must navigate workouts without his primary training partner, fellow IFBB Pro Brett Wilkin, he’s taken solace in his possible new home gym only 15 minutes from home. He believes the move best aligns with his latest bodybuilding goals.
“We’re moving to Texas for some bigger opportunities and to continue to make our environment what we want it to be. We’ll get Brett out here with me and continue to push each other,” Fitzwater shared.

Fitzwater is intentional about every product he adds to his cart. Aside from selections made by his partner, Wellness IFBB Pro Alexis Adams, Fitzwater aims to eat clean, whole foods leading up to his contest prep. As expected, a handful of high-protein sources, like eggs, egg whites, and ground turkey, were thrown in the mix.
Fitzwater avoids sugar alcohols as much as possible, a wise choice since they have been shown in some people to cause bloating and abdominal discomfort. (1) Picking a beverage like Gatorade during workouts supports Fitzwater’s hydration through electrolyte balance, boosting his performance inside the gym. (2)
Fitzwater’s fat-free, lactose-free Fairlife milk is a stellar option for building lean mass, strength, and power post-workout. (3)
With the 16-hour drive in his rearview, Fitzwater looks ahead to the Pittsburgh Pro, which is set to host the Open class for the first time from May 10-11. A $100,000 prize awaits the champion. To wear that crown, Fitzwater must overwhelm a powerful lineup and, of course, get the better of Walker in their rematch.
